Uplifting CommUnity Health Month: April 2026
Western Illinois University will join the nation in recognizing April as Uplifting CommUnity Health Month with a variety of activities that have been planned to kick off this month-long celebration.
This Year's Theme: "Resilience: The Strength of Our CommUnity"
